The GPS coordinates of Zhonghe, China are 28.450490, 108.989010 in decimal degrees, which is 28° 27' 1.8" N, 108° 59' 20.4" E in degrees, minutes and seconds. Zhonghe lies in the northern and eastern hemispheres and has a population of approximately 105,003.
